PRODUCT DETAILS

Volume Two continues Four Ways West Publications Publications' New Haven Railroad pictorial series of all-color books, this time focusing on New Haven's operations in central Connecticut and Rhode Island.

This book also reviews New Haven's road-switchers and switchers purchased from ALCO, EMD, Fairbanks-Morse, General Electric and Lima between 1931 and 1965.

The photographic trip begins at Old Saybrook and covers New Haven's back lines in Connecticut and the branch lines of Rhode Island as well as the Shore Line route from New London to Providence ending at Boston Switch.

Four Ways West Publications, hardcover, 128 pages, standard portrait book 8 x 10 in., all Color photographs.
